24 6502 Subroutine Instructions • JSR: Jump to subroutine • RTS: Return from subroutine Philipp Koehn Computer Systems Fundamentals: 6502 Stack
lecture stack
A Edwards 6502 image from https://www pagetable com/?p=1295 JSR $ FDED pushes the program counter onto the stack then jumps to $FDED RTS pops
vcf programming
Moving Data Using the Stack 65802/65816: Stack Overruns Program or Data JSR Jump to subroutine LDA Load accumulator from memory LDX
wdc programming manual
The JSR (Jump to Subroutine) instruction saves the address of its own third byte in the stack, that is, JSR saves the return address minus 1 RTS (Return from
assembly
6502-Conj-de-Instrucoes doc Pull processor status from stack All Subroutine and Interrupt Group JSR Jump to a subroutine RTS Return from subroutine
Conj de Instrucoes
6502 Processor Instruction Set Push processor status on stack PHP $08 1 Subroutine and Interrupt Group JSR Jump to a subroutine JSR $aaaa $20 3
Conjunto de Instrucoes
Programmable Stack Pointer Variable Length JSR Jump to New Location Saving Return Address LDA Load performance than the original NMOS 6502
JSR and RTS use something called the stack to accomplish thefeat of returning after a subroutine has been completed The 6502 stack is two things, working
The Visible Computer Manual text
mode for JSR As an example of this Transfer from stack (that is, pull) OR AND There is one more 6502 addressing mode which we have not covered in the
bbm A F
JSR: Jump to subroutine. • RTS: Return from subroutine. Philipp Koehn. Computer Systems Fundamentals: 6502 Stack. 20 September 2019
Stephen A. Edwards. 6502 image from https://www.pagetable.com/?p=1295 JSR $FDED pushes the program counter onto the stack then jumps to $FDED.
Recall: 6502. – JSR stored return address on stack. – RTS retrieved return address from stack. – special instructions to store accumulator status register.
Computer Systems Fundamentals: 6502 Interrupt and Bus. 23 September 2019 Interrupt call pushes status register to stack ... 20 24 EA JSR $EA24.
Programmable Stack Pointer. • Variable Length Stack SY6502. SY6507. 28. SY6512 External 40 ... JSR Jump to New Location Saving Return Address.
Shahrivar 23 1398 AP Multi-tasking on a 6502 faces significant obstacles: ... single
mode for JSR. As an example of this Transfer from stack (that is
The 65816 starts as 6502 clone in “emulation mode”. • We just switched from NES to SNES write stack low byte ... ldx #$00 jsr (current_init_slotx).
Programming model of the 6502 CPU CPU Register
JSR WR03. 72B1. Type a byte in hex. JSR RDHSR 733D Read a character from None vided the stack does not overflow TIM will restore the stack.